Job description
Overview
This is a stable, long-term part-time opportunity that can be done remotely. The role is focused on academic manuscript review in the field of law, where you will help assess the quality, originality, and scholarly value of submissions.
Candidate Profile
Applicants should hold a PhD or an equivalent advanced qualification in the subject area. A strong academic publication record is required, including at least five papers published in SCI or SSCI journals within the last three years. Prior peer-review experience for academic journals is considered a strong advantage.
Key Duties
You will review manuscripts for originality, methodological soundness, relevance of the literature cited, and whether conclusions are properly supported by the evidence. The role also involves identifying issues, offering clear and constructive comments, and helping the editor form a recommendation on acceptance, revision, or rejection.
Additional Requirements
Success in this role depends on strong analytical judgment, critical thinking, and the ability to write feedback that is concise, clear, and useful. You should be comfortable working to deadlines, managing your time effectively, maintaining confidentiality, and remaining objective throughout the review process. Familiarity with online manuscript submission and review platforms is also needed.
